**Job description**
Tamarack Industries, leader in mobile glycol heating systems is looking for a Procurement Specialist to join our team and help managing our organization’s procurement needs. The Procurement Specialist responsibilities will include processing purchase orders, negotiating with suppliers and ensuring timely delivery of the orders, creating and maintaining an inventory, quality assurance and liaising with production department.
**Responsibilities**
- Monitoring supplier performance and resolving issues and concerns.
- Conducting research on potential products, vendors, and services, and comparing price and quality to ensure the best deal.
- Comparing prices amongst various vendors in order to make sound purchasing decisions
- Researching and identifying prospective suppliers.
- Negotiating with vendors on price, mode of shipping, and delivery time
- Compiling data relating to supplier performance to enable evaluation
- Contacting suppliers to resolve price, quality, delivery or invoice issues
- Scheduling purchase orders strategically to ensure continuity of supplies
- Expediting orders when supplies are low
- Determining the required materials and generating purchase orders
- Monitoring inventory and writing orders to refill stock.
- Preparing reports and maintaining accurate inventory and procurement records.
- Updating all records of purchased products.
- Writing reports on purchases made and performing cost analyses.
- Entering data concerning inventory and order amounts into the ERP
- Other tasks and initiatives as assigned
**Skills and Requirements**
- Excellent communication, organizational and time management skills with the ability to consistently meet deadlines.
- Innovative self-starter, detail-oriented and be able to work independently and as part of a multi-skilled team.
- Supply chain experience working on complex procurements or related experience in strategic sourcing and subcontract management.
- Experience with price analyses, source selection and justification
- 3+ years’ experience as a Procurement Specialist or similar role
- Good working knowledge of purchasing strategies.
- Excellent interpersonal and negotiation skills
- Strong analytical thinking and problem-solving skills
- A bachelor’s degree in business administration, supply chain management or a similar field will be an asset.
